1.12.2 Installing the PeopleSoft ePay Payslips Functionality
To install PeopleSoft ePay Payslips for PeopleSoft Global Payroll:
-
Confirm the jar installation by verifying that the following two jar files are installed in your <PS_APP_HOME>\class directory:
Note:
For a UNIX platform, the class files are in the <PS_APP_HOME>\appserv\classes directory.
-
itext-1.4.7.jar
-
com.peoplesoft.hmcr.exceptions.jar
-
-
Update URL IDs in the PeopleSoft system to point to the FTP site.
The URL ID is pointing to a virtual directory on the FTP site. You can create this virtual directory “PAYSLIPS” in the FTP root, however the PeopleSoft ePay process creates this folder if it did not previously exist. You can choose to create a directory by any name or structure (you are not limited to using “PAYSLIPS”). If you create a different directory, you must ensure that you reference this directory in the URL ID.
-
Select PeopleTools, Utilities, Administration, Maintain URLs.
-
Select the following URL Identifier:
GP_SS_PSLP_FTP
-
Update this URL with the FTP payslip URL, including the user ID used to log on to the FTP session, password, and computer name; for example:
ftp://<FTPUSER>:<FTPPASSWORD>@<COMPUTERNAME>/PAYSLIPS/
-
-
Check the URL setting in Self Service Payslip Options, as follows:
-
Select Set Up HCM, Product Related, ePay, Self Service Payslip Options.
-
Search for the Global Payroll Country for which you are installing PeopleSoft ePay Payslips. Ensure that the URL setting is the URL Identifier from the prior step.
Important:
You may create your own URL ID and update this URL, instead of using GP_SS_PSLP_FTP. If you create your own URL ID you must update the Self Service Payslip Options to point to your new URL ID.
See PeopleSoft HCM: ePay, "Setting Up View Payslips."
-
-
Check the PeopleSoft Installation Table Settings, as follows:
-
Enter Installation Table in the keyword input field of the Global Search bar. As you type, the suggestions are updated to reflect the search term or terms you have entered.
-
Select Installation Table from the search suggestions.
Note:
To navigate to the page using the Navbar button, select Set Up HCM, Install, Installation Table.
-
Select the ePay check box on the main Installation Table tab (Products).
-
If any changes are necessary to the Installation Table, this informational message appears “You must log off and log back on at all clients and application servers for changes to take effect,” as shown in the following example:
Figure 1-9 Informational Message

-
-
Log off all clients, shut down and restart all application servers, and then log back on to PeopleSoft HCM for your change to take effect.
